He demanded an entire city, a capital: Chandigarh. He wanted a \u2018symbol of India&#8217;s liberation\u2019, a new city for a new people, liberated from British colonisation and partition. With this request, he turned to Corbusier, who asked Pierre Jeanneret to build Chandigarh. Together with some English architects and the young Indian architects they trained, Pierre Jeanneret designed and built tens of thousands of houses, hospitals, libraries, cinemas, shops, administrative buildings and so on. They had the idea of a new ecological city in which 500,000 trees would be planted, a new city that would combine Western modernity with Indian culture.<\/p>\n<p>The film \u2018&#8230; et Pierre Jeanneret\u2019 is a documentary essay, a poetic film that combines literature and cinema.
